Book excerpt: The most difficult and frustrating problem facing those responsble for the development of a sound transportation system is the one involving overall transportation facilties in the metropolitan and urban areas. The problem is at least two-fold: first, very complex studies, negotiations and agreements are necessary to achieve acceptable and satisfactory solutions; second, there is the issue of overall financing of accepted solutions. It pays to start with state-city-county cooperation, to continue with it, and to follow through with it. Another important element is the participation of the state legislature. California has a history of teamwork in road, street and highway matters among the various jurisdictions concerned. This teamwork involves financing as well as planning and construction.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: High skilled workers gain from face to face interactions. If the skilled can move at higher speeds, then knowledge diffusion and idea spillovers are likely to reach greater distances. This paper uses the construction of China's high speed rail (HSR) network as a natural experiment to test this claim. HSR connects major cities, that feature the nation's best universities, to secondary cities. Since bullet trains reduce cross-city commute times, they reduce the cost of face-to-face interactions between skilled workers who work in different cities. Using a data base listing research paper publication and citations, we document a complementarity effect between knowledge production and the transportation network. Co-authors' productivity rises and more new co-author pairs emerge when secondary cities are connected by bullet train to China's major cities.

Book excerpt: This report of the Transportation Research Board will be of interest to transit staff interested in implementing leadership development initiatives at their agencies. Current practices, major issues, trends, and innovations related to the use of corporate culture as the driver in hiring, developing, evaluating, and retaining a leadership team, within and outside the transit industry were documented for this synthesis. The report discusses the state of the practice in leadership recruitment, development, evaluation, and retention. It reports on innovative approaches to the problems faced in todays work environment in transit and other industries. This synthesis also covers the manner in which corporate culture affects the hiring, development, evaluation, and retention of the top management team.
